Großholthausen
Großholthausen is a suburb in Dortmund, Arnsberg, North Rhine-Westphalia. Großholthausen is situated nearby to the suburb Löttringhausen, as well as near Kruckel.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Dortmund-Kruckel station lies on the border between the suburbs of Dortmund-Kruckel and Dortmund-Persebeck of the city of Dortmund in the German state of North Rhine-Westphalia on the Elberfeld–Dortmund line.

Dortmund-Löttringhausen station is on the former Rhenish Railway Company in the suburb of Löttringhausen in the Dortmund district of Hombruch in the German state of North Rhine-Westphalia.
